The Enchanted Bazaar: A Thousand Gold for a Neighbor's Secret
In the heart of the ancient city of Luminara, there stood an enigmatic bazaar known as The Enchanted Bazaar. It was a place where the ordinary met the extraordinary, where the mundane was woven into the fabric of the magical. The bazaar was a labyrinth of stalls, each offering wares that defied the laws of nature. From potions that granted temporary invisibility to mirrors that revealed the deepest secrets of the soul, the bazaar was a treasure trove for those who dared to seek its wonders.
One such seeker was Li, a humble tailor with a penchant for the extraordinary. Li had heard tales of the bazaar's wonders and had always dreamed of finding something that would change his life. One crisp autumn morning, Li decided to set out on a journey to the bazaar, armed with nothing but his wits and a determination to uncover the mysteries that lay within.
Upon arriving at the bazaar, Li was immediately struck by the vibrant colors and the cacophony of sounds that filled the air. Stalls selling exotic spices, shimmering fabrics, and mysterious artifacts lined the narrow streets. Li wandered through the crowd, his eyes wide with wonder, when he heard a voice call out, "A thousand gold for a neighbor's secret!"
Curiosity piqued, Li approached the stall where the voice had originated. There, he found an old woman with a knowing smile, her eyes twinkling with mischief. "A thousand gold for a neighbor's secret," she repeated. "You can ask any neighbor, and for a thousand gold pieces, I will reveal their deepest, darkest secret."
Li's heart raced with excitement. He had always been intrigued by the lives of his neighbors, each with their own stories and secrets. But a thousand gold pieces was a fortune, and Li knew he could not afford to squander it lightly. He pondered the offer for a moment before deciding to take a chance.
"Who would you like me to ask?" the old woman inquired, her eyes narrowing with anticipation.
Li hesitated, then spoke. "I would like to know the secret of the richest man in the city, Master Chen."
The old woman's smile widened. "Ah, Master Chen. A wise and powerful man, indeed. But be warned, his secret is as deep as the ocean and as dangerous as a serpent."
Li nodded, his resolve unshaken. "I am ready to pay the price."
The old woman nodded and began to weave a spell, her fingers moving with a precision that belied her age. In moments, a shimmering portal appeared before Li, and he stepped through, finding himself in the opulent home of Master Chen.
Master Chen was a man of great wealth and power, his home filled with gold and jewels. Li approached him with respect, his heart pounding with anticipation. "I have come to ask you a question, Master Chen. For a thousand gold pieces, I will hear your deepest, darkest secret."
Master Chen's eyes narrowed, but he nodded. "Very well. Ask your question."
Li took a deep breath. "What is your greatest secret, Master Chen?"
To Li's shock, Master Chen did not hesitate. "My greatest secret is that I am not who I appear to be. I am, in fact, a sorcerer who has hidden my true identity for many years. I have used my power to amass my wealth and influence, but I have always feared that someone would uncover my secret and destroy everything I have built."
Li was astounded. He had never imagined that the richest man in the city was a sorcerer. But as he pondered the revelation, he realized that Master Chen's secret was not the one he had been expecting.
As Li left Master Chen's home, he felt a strange sense of purpose. He had learned a valuable lesson about the nature of secrets and the true cost of power. But as he walked through the bustling streets of the bazaar, he noticed something odd. The old woman's stall was gone, and the voice that had called out to him was nowhere to be found.
Li's heart raced with fear. He had been tricked! The old woman had not revealed Master Chen's secret; she had revealed his own. Li had become the neighbor with a secret, and now he was the one who needed to protect his identity.
Li hurried back to his home, his mind racing with thoughts. He knew that he had to be careful. The old woman's offer had been a ruse, and he had been the one to fall for it. But as he sat in his humble abode, he realized that the greatest secret of all was the one he had kept from himself.
Li had always been content with his simple life, but now he saw the potential for something more. He could use his newfound knowledge to help others, to uncover the truth behind the lives of those around him. And perhaps, in doing so, he could find the courage to face the secrets that lay within himself.
The Enchanted Bazaar had given Li more than he had ever imagined. It had given him a glimpse into the magical world that lay just beyond the veil of reality, and it had shown him the power of secrets and the importance of truth. And as he closed his eyes and took a deep breath, Li knew that his journey was just beginning.
